Bangladesh is a country deeply rooted in cultural diversity. With a rich history that spans centuries, this South Asian nation is home to a melting pot of ethnicities, religions, languages, and traditions. This cultural diversity not only shapes the unique identity of Bangladesh but also paves the way for Skills development and innovation. ### Cultural Diversity in Bangladesh Bangladesh's cultural tapestry is woven with influences from various sources, including indigenous communities, Hinduism, Islam, Buddhism, and colonial legacies. The country celebrates numerous festivals, such as Pohela Boishakh (Bengali New Year), Durga Puja, Eid ul-Fitr, and Christmas, reflecting its diverse cultural heritage. The vibrant music, dance, art, and cuisine further showcase the richness of Bangladeshi culture. ### Impact on Skills Development The cultural diversity in Bangladesh plays a crucial role in skills development by fostering creativity, empathy, and collaboration.
